## Changelog — Gridmaster Admin 4.2

Defaults changed for bulk edits in the admin table. Batch size lowered, optimistic locking now on by default, and soft-delete confirmation applies to multi-row operations. Plugins relying on the old fire-and-forget bulk hook must opt in explicitly or edits over fifty rows will be rejected. The legacy behavior flag remains available through 4.4, then it is removed. The new default configuration shipped with this release is shown below.

deployment values, yadug-bawif:
[framir]
team = pelox
access_code = ac_a38ab2
owner = tamion.julael
host = framir.tolvaqlabs.test
port = 11211
peer = tammir.zemvargrid.local
salt = 2215ef03
pin = 1541

MINUTES — Management Meeting

Subject: Training budget for next year. The committee, chaired by Edda Marwin, reviewed branch submissions and agreed a provisional uplift of eight percent, weighted toward compliance and the new Loralet till system. Branch managers should note that discretionary course approvals will now route through regional offices, and unused allocations lapse at year-end rather than rolling forward. Final figures follow board sign-off in November. The confidential note below outlines the plans informing these allocations.

board note of baguf-fafog: Kasixox Foods plans to lower the Drueth list price by 48 percent in March.

Subject: Handover — Quotaline release duties

Taking over from me this cycle: per-tenant rate quotas in Quotaline are enforced at the Marrowgate proxy, and plugin authors must declare expected request ceilings in their manifest. Quota overrides ship as signed config bundles; the proxy drops anything unsigned, no logs, so don't skip it. Release cadence is Tuesdays, freeze Mondays at noon. Everything else is in the runbook. The bundle signing key currently in rotation is included below.

deploy key for kajof-yawif: bky9_fvxrpdHPq

## Releases

Quick note for the sync: the nightly search reindex on Mossgate now ships as its own release artifact instead of piggybacking on the API deploy. It runs at 01:30, takes ~20 minutes, and rolls back automatically on checksum mismatch. Artifacts must be signed before the runner will touch them. The key we sign reindex artifacts with is below.

release key, bagep-yajof: bky19_xtqFhCW5hRYj5CXT2ZJ